Done deal. Picked up the bike tonight a 9:30 PM. Wow! What a bike! Driving it again, looking at all of the details up close for an hour (I drooled all over it once I got it home & in the garage) - I can see that I actually got quite the steal, even at $1100.
And yes, I will post pics ASAP.
1978 KZ650 - 14K miles - Super clean, light mods.
What amazes me, aside from how smooth it runs and rides, is how clean it is. The wheels (including hubs & hardware) look like day one. Brand new Dunlops all around (rear is 130). The engine is pretty much spotless, and the Mikunis look sweet. Stock 4 into 2 exhaust is superb. Everything right down to the wiring is super clean and exhibits a well cared for bike. I'm really digging the Drag Specialties Seat/Fender combo - gives that great cafe look. It's got what I believe to be a CSR (?) stubby front fender. The PO had her painted up in satin black, with a 4" gloss black stripe down the center of the tank and rear fender - looks to be a pretty solid job, although I'll probably go with Metallic Flake Blue with a White Center Stripe.
Can't wait till you guys see her - like I said... pics coming soon!
Proud to be a KZ owner. This bike is the balls. Totally bangin'!
